Idaho Chapter National Electrical Contractors Association Inc, founded in 1978, is a community nonprofit that reported $1.4M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 45%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$514K, a strong 36% operating margin.

Mission

To represent, promote and advance the interests of the electrical contracting industry in the state of Idaho.
